The Priest's Cane
Long, long ago a poor woman was sewing alone at her house in a mountain village. An old priest came to her home and asked her for a cup of water.
"Excuse me, but I'm so thirsty after a long walk. Would you give me a cup of water.?"
"Of course, yes. But now we have run out of water. I'll bring it immediately in the river. You can take a rest here."
On saying so, she ran down the mountain to the river with a wooden bucket and brought a bucket of water an hour later.
The priest was so moved by her kindness and said to her,
"Thank you very much for your kindness. I'll make you free from such painful labor."
After saying so, he stood in front of her house and struck the ground with his cane. To her surprise, water sprang up from there.
The old priest went away without her noticing it.
The Waterless River
Long, long ago a young wife was washing sweet potatoes in a stream. A poor, dirty priest came to her and asked her,
"Excuse me, but I'm so hungry after a long walk. Would you give me a potato?"
"I have no potatoes to give a poor and dirty man like you." refused she.
The priest stood in front of the stream and whispered a pray with his eyes closed and his hands folded.
Strange to say, the water of the stream gradually became lower and lower until it never ran.
